+Respect subpath URL paths in the fetchContent url property.
+
+This fixes an issue where fetchContent() URL property did not include the buildOptions.site path in it.

+Standardize trailing subpath behavior in config.
+
+Most users are not aware of the subtle differences between `/foo` and `/foo/`. Internally, we have to handle both which means that we are constantly worrying about the format of the URL, needing to add/remove trailing slashes when we go to work with this property, etc. This change transforms all `site` values to use a trailing slash internally, which should help reduce bugs for both users and maintainers. \ No newline at end of file
